GitHub regularly removes copyright-infringing IPTV repositories due to DMCA takedowns. Any links I could provide would likely be: IPTV Playlist: The file containing channel links
- IPTV Playlist: The file containing channel links.
- GitHub: The world’s largest coding repository. Developers use GitHub to host code, but clever users also host raw text files (playlists) there because the platform offers free, high-bandwidth hosting.
- 8000: This number indicates the scale. An "8000" playlist suggests the file contains approximately 8,000 channels from around the globe. This is massive, covering everything from US news and UK sports to obscure Asian cinema and European documentaries.
- Worldwide: The playlist is not region-locked. It includes channels from dozens of countries.
- Patched: This is the most crucial word. Free IPTV links die frequently. Servers go offline, links expire, or IP addresses change. A "patched" playlist means that the uploader has recently updated (or "patched") the dead links, replacing them with fresh, working URLs. It implies the playlist is alive and maintained.
